The Streptavidin (Peroxidase/HRP Conjugated) is a high-quality detection reagent designed for use in a wide range of immunoassay applications, including immunohistochemistry on frozen (IHC-F) and paraffin-embedded (IHC-P) tissue sections, Western blotting (WB), and direct ELISA assays. This conjugate is produced by coupling streptavidin to horseradish peroxidase (HRP) and purified by affinity chromatography, ensuring exceptional specificity for biotin-containing molecules. Supplied in a stabilized PBS buffer formulation containing 0.1% Proclin300, 1% protective protein, and 50% glycerol at pH 7.4, this product offers excellent stability and reproducible performance. It is compatible with enhanced chemiluminescent and DAB detection systems for Western blot, as well as TMB-based colorimetric detection for ELISA, making it an excellent choice for both routine assays and high-sensitivity research applications.
